Cameron Diaz expressed her fears over being an ‘older mother’ with other moms ‘literally 20 years younger’ just days before welcoming her third child aged 53

Just days before announcing the birth of her third child, Cameron Diaz admitted she felt ‘pressure’ to live a long, healthy life as an older mother.

The 53-year-old Hollywood star and her 47-year-old musician husband Benji Madden shared the news about the arrival of their son Nautas Madden on Instagram on Sunday, stating that they were “happy, excited and feeling very happy.”

The couple, who married in 2015, are already parents to six-year-old daughter Raddix and two-year-old son Cardinal, who was born via surrogate.

Just days before the surprise birth was announced, Cameron expressed her fear of becoming an older mother, admitting that she had befriended other mums ‘literally 20 years younger than her’.

Reminding that she took a break from acting for 10 years and prioritized her marriage and children, Cameron said that becoming a mother for the first time at the age of 47 made her more focused on aging better.

‘I love being a mother. This is the best, best, best part of my life. The only pressure for me now is that I have to live to be 107, you know?’
